2025 U.S. Championships | Senior WAG Day 1 Live Blog

Welcome to the live blog for the first day of senior women’s competition at the 2025 U.S. Championships, held in New Orleans, Louisiana.

Please refresh your browser every few minutes to see the most recent updates, which will appear at the top of the page.

9:58 pm. Day 1 Standings

1. Hezly Rivera 55.600
2. Joscelyn Roberson 55.400
3. Leanne Wong 55.100
4. Dulcy Caylor 53.800
5. Gabrielle Hardie 53.750
6. Ashlee Sullivan 53.700
7. Simone Rose 53.450
8. Izzy Stassi 53.300
9. Tiana Sumanasekera 53.100
10. Brooke Pierson 52.450
11. Jayla Hang 52.250
12. Nola Matthews 52.150
13. Harlow Buddendeck 52.000
14. Alicia Zhou 51.950
15. Claire Pease 51.600
16. Reese Esponda 51.350
17. Annalisa Milton 51.300
18. Jordis Eichman 51.250
19. Catherine Guy 50.550
20. Ally Damelio 50.450
21. Alessia Rosa 36.100
22. Skye Blakely 26.600
23. Tatum Drusch 24.800

Apparatus leaders are Leanne Wong with a 13.675 on vault, Alicia Zhou and Joscelyn Roberson with a 13.650 on bars, Hezly Rivera with a 14.350 on beam, and Joscelyn Roberson with a 14.150 on floor.

9:56 pm. Catherine Guy BB: Some form and wobble on the bhs loso. Good front aerial to jumps and side aerial. Hit the 1.5 dismount. 12.500

9:54 pm. Hezly Rivera UB: Weiler half to toe full I think, a bit late there, Chow to Ricna, lovely Pak, Maloney to Tkachev, full-in with a step. 13.450

9:53 pm. Izzy Stassi BB: Jumping into this a bit late on the stream, I think I’m only gonna get the dismount…yeah, double tuck, chest down and a step back. 13.150

9:52 pm. Alicia Zhou FX: Clean double pike with a small bounce back. Hit the second pass and then just a front full for the third and final. Simple set but lovely performance. 12.500

9:48 pm. Simone Rose BB: Switch leap mount with a small wobble. Bhs loso loso, could extend a bit more throughout but solid landing. Side aerial to split jump to straddle jump, connection was slightly slow to the jumps. Front aerial, slight wobble. 2.5 with a hop forward. 13.100

Skye Blakely UB: Nice control before the stalder to Church, Downie to Pak, toe full to van Leeuwen I think after that, some form on the van Leeuwen and she has to pause with her hips on the high bar for a second before casting up again, toe half to front giant to double front half, good landing. 13.150

9:46 pm. Nola Matthews UB: I missed the beginning, caught it from the Pak, toe full was really late, short handstand before the van Leeuwen, toe-on, and a double layout dismount, tucked her legs a bit to get it around. 12.800

9:43 pm. Joscelyn Roberson FX: Went for the Moors, form isn’t truly there but got it around and to her feet with a hop to the side. Next is a front full through to full-in, some more form and a step back OOB. Full-twisting double layout with a hop back. Double layout with a small hop back. REALLY strong tumbling that just needs to be tidied up a bit. 14.150

9:41 pm. Harlow Buddendeck UB: She hit everything at the beginning, I started typing at the van Leeuwen which had some minor form as did the full pirouette after, double layout with a small step on the landing. Little things throughout but a hit, and she had a great day overall! 13.050

Brooke Pierson VT: Yurchenko 1.5, pretty good overall! Small hop forward. 13.450

9:24 pm. Jordis Eichman FX: Full-in to start, a bit short with a bounce. Hit the 1.5 to front full well. Good landing on the double tuck at the end. 12.950

9:21 pm. Tiana Sumanasekera FX: Double layout to split jump, not the most controlled in the jump but not bad either. Clean double tuck. Switch ring to switch full. Came short out of the 1.5 and still went for the front full, which was really low and kinda wild, ended up crashing it. Got the double pike at the end. 12.400

9:20 pm. Ally Damelio BB: I jumped into this a little late, caught up at the switch leap to sissone which was lovely. Double full dismount. 12.750

9:18 pm. Izzy Stassi UB: Weiler half to Bhardwaj, some leg separation but love that combo. Maloney to clear hip full with some leg form, Ray, Pak with leg and foot form, van Leeuwen with some more leg form, solid double layout with a hop back. 13.400

9:16 pm. Reese Esponda FX: Double double, big bounce back into a lunge, OOB. Double layout was a little low and long but landed well enough, bouncy though. Think she did a whip half to double tuck for the next one? Landed well. Low set in the double pike, lands a bit deep there. 13.250

Simone Rose UB: 13.350

9:14 pm. Joscelyn Roberson BB: Standing full was strong! Switch to switch half, really short, to back tuck. Nailed the triple flight series. Onodi to straddle to pike jumps, good. Double pike, low set and chest down with a step on the landing. 13.800

8:54 pm. Tiana Sumanasekera BB: Bhs bhs layout, not bad! Front aerial to split jump to sissone. Switch to switch half to Korbut, good. Ring leap was a little iffy in the air and on the landing, but recovered well into the next couple of skills. Double pike, chest at her knees, step back. 13.800

Alessia Rosa VT: 13.600

8:52 pm. Harlow Buddendeck FX: Ooh, nice triple full to start! Memmel turn was a little rushed and not super precise. Tour jeté full. 1.5 to front layout, a little arched and steps out of it. Lovely switch ring to straddle 3/4 I think that was. Low set on the double pike and she lands with her chest down. Some lovely work overall! 13.000

8:50 pm. Reese Esponda BB: Gets the wolf turn around, think she did a double but I missed the beginning. Standing back tuck, solid. Bhs layout, some leg form and a big wobble on the landing. Side aerial to split jump to straddle jump, the latter looked a little short. Double pike, deep landing with a hop. 12.400

8:48 pm. Claire Pease FX: Starts with a double pike, I think that’s a downgrade? 2.5 with a lunge forward into a kind of lackluster arabesque. Oh, the double pike wasn’t where she started, it’s simply where the stream started because that was the end of the routine. 12.050

8:47 pm. Ashlee Sullivan BB: Double wolf turn. Arabian had a big wobble, bhs loso loso ended up a bit short with some form throughout. Good fight on both. Front aerial to straddle to split jumps. Onodi wasn’t super precise but she gets it around. Switch leap. Double pike with a solid landing. 13.650

8:45 pm. Joscelyn Roberson UB: Maloney with some leg separation to clear hip half to Ezhova, full pirouette I think to a shaposh to Gienger, couldn’t see some of the root skills due to coach Chris Brooks blocking our view, nailed the full twisting double layout dismount. Nice hit! Form throughout but solid. 13.650

8:25 pm. Claire Pease BB: Double wolf turn to start followed by clean jumps to Onodi. Super solid bhs loso loso! Front aerial a little slow to the straddle jump but gets that to the back handspring. Clean side aerial. Switch half could’ve had a little more amplitude. 2.5 with some leg form and a step to the side. 13.900

Alessia Rosa scratched floor FYI.

8:20 pm. Leanne Wong BB: Good switch leap mount and strong side aerial. Switch leap to switch half, the first was good but the latter was a bit short, connected that to a split jump. Switch ring, back knee a little low. Bhs loso could be more extended but landed well. Double wolf turn, good. Front aerial, didn’t connect to split jump to back handspring but all nice on their own. Little check on the side somi. Sticks the tucked gainer full off the end. 13.750

8:18 pm. Jayla Hang FX: Double wolf turn before her first pass, a 2.5, which landed REALLY short, she still went for the punch front layout, which ended up really low and long but she somehow kept it on her feet. Whip full through to double tuck I think after that? Better on the landing. Switch half to switch full. Dobule pike, set was really low, lands short again but can’t save it this time, hands down. 12.200

8:16 pm. Hezly Rivera BB: Double wolf turn was fine. Side aerial with a minor check into a gorgeous split jump to straddle jump. Bhs layout with a minor check on the landing. Switch half was really short, to Korbut, kinda slow to connect but not that bad. Front aerial slow into the split ring jump as well but she kinda showed continuous movement there? Switch ring with a little wobble. Double pike set was low, landed with her chest down and a step back. 14.050

Ashlee Sullivan UB: 12.050

8:13 pm. Catherine Guy FX: Front layout to rudi, a little short with some form in the air. Hit the 1.5 to front full after that. Switch ring to switch half. Double tuck with a big bounce back. 12.650

8:11 pm. Skye Blakely BB: Good on the mount sequence into the triple wolf turn, which looked perf. Very controlled and clean. Standing full with the tiniest little step. Front handspring to front tuck, overrotates and has to grab the beam unfortunately. Switch with a low back leg and slow into the switch half, slight check there. Front aerial to split jump to wolf jump. Double tuck dismount with a step back. 13.450

Dulcy Caylor UB: Toe full to Maloney to low Tkachev, clean Pak and van Leeuwen, blind change to straddle Jaeger, a little low but not bad, double layout, stuck! Wow, pretty solid for her. 13.600

8:09 pm. Brooke Pierson UB: Stalder full to Maloney to Pak, leg separation on the latter. Van Leeuwen legs were a bit all over the place, stalder half to straddle Jaeger was very nice, toe half to double front, cowboyed with a bounce into a lunge forward. 13.250

Gabrielle Hardie VT: Good Yurchenko 1.5, small hop on the landing but overall nice. 13.800
